    It could be like dan says oil dripping on to the exhaust, it could be an oil leak in to the cylinder if the headgasket hasn't sealed properly, or it could be one of the new valve stem oil seals has come loose, you may be able to see the later by removing the rocker cover? or check the plugs to see if one of the plugs is oiled up.

    Ste, not having a dig just curious, how do the vavle stem oil seals cause oil to leak past the rings? I thought all they did was stop oil leaking down the valve stems in to the inlet ports. If the valves have been re-lapped giving a better seal and more compression as a result this could cause it to leak past the rings instead, I think?
